What does θέρος (théros) mean in the Bible?

θέρος (théros) is a Greek word meaning "summer".

How does the BSB render G2330?

The BSB source-word alignment has 3 aligned rows for this entry. Common renderings include summer (3).

Where does θέρος (théros) appear in Scripture?

The source-word alignment first shows this entry at Matthew 24:32. Its strongest book concentrations include Luke (1), Mark (1), Matthew (1).
